🛸 CASE FILE #145 The CLARITY Act Just Hit a MAJOR Timing Problem. House Republicans canceled voting for the weeks of Sept. 21 and Sept. 28, leaving just four voting days before lawmakers head home ahead of the midterms. The Senate’s Sept. 15 vote is only a procedural step. If senators amend the CLARITY Act, the bill must return to the House before reaching Trump’s desk. That window is now extremely tight — pushing the bill closer to a post-election lame-duck session.

🛸 CASE FILE #144 The U.S. Pays Over 1 TRILLION DOLLARS in Interest — Now Treasury Is Expanding Its Own Debt Buybacks. With federal debt above 40 trillion dollars and bond yields surging, Treasury is increasing long-term buybacks starting September 9, doubling some operations from 2 billion to at least 4 billion dollars. Important: the 12.5 billion-dollar operation is a cash-management buyback, not a sudden new bailout or QE program. Treasury has been running buybacks routinely. America’s debt problem is getting more expensive.

🛸 CASE FILE #139 Europe Wants Crypto OUT of Tax-Advantaged Savings Accounts. The EU recommends excluding crypto assets from its new Savings and Investment Accounts, while allowing stocks, bonds and funds. Ireland is now following that approach, excluding direct crypto as "highly complex and risky." But ETFs remain eligible — meaning crypto exposure through an ETF can qualify, while holding actual Bitcoin cannot. Bitcoin exposure gets the tax advantage. Bitcoin itself doesn’t.

🛸 CASE FILE #135 NASA Is Sending a Nuclear-Powered Spacecraft to Mars in 2028. NASA’s Space Reactor-1 Freedom is targeting late 2028 to become the first fission-powered interplanetary spacecraft, demonstrating nuclear-electric propulsion on a Mars flyby mission. Nuclear-electric propulsion uses propellant far more efficiently than conventional chemical systems, potentially opening the door to much more ambitious deep-space missions. The next space race may be powered by nuclear energy.

🛸 CASE FILE #133 Trump Calls It "The Biggest Oil Deal in World History." The U.S. and Venezuela have struck a sweeping deal covering 17 oil fields with roughly 65 billion barrels of potential reserves. The reported structure gives the U.S. 55% of the venture’s effective output, including rights to buy crude at cost, while Venezuela could receive around 100 billion dollars in investment. Trump also says Venezuelan crude will help refill America’s Strategic Petroleum Reserve. 65 billion barrels. Energy geopolitics just changed.

🛸 CASE FILE #131 Did Kevin Warsh Accidentally Fool the Trading Algos With One Word? Warsh opened Jackson Hole repeatedly talking about "hikes" hiking trails, not interest-rate hikes and even called his speech outline a "trail map." The unusual wording came as markets rapidly repriced his remarks as hawkish. Some traders are now speculating that headline-reading algos may have interpreted "hike" as a monetary-policy signal. There’s no proof the wording caused the move but the timing has raised eyebrows. Did the algos hear "rate hike" when Warsh was just talking about a hike?
